I have been teaching for around 8 years in UK schools, as well as in international schools in Tanzania, China and Romania. Because of this experience, I am interested in making resources that teach my students about other countries, as well as resources about festivals, celebrations and special days. I also enjoy writing short children's stories, so you may see some of those uploaded from time to time.

This resource introduces the history of International Women's Day on the 8th March and what the day represents. In some countries, International Women's Day is like Mothers' Day, where women are given gifts. Other countries hold onto the political significance of International Women's Day, where women around the world stand up for women's rights. The resource contains images and facts that you can show and discuss with your students, both in a classroom and whole-school setting. Please note, this resource is a PDF.
